|
|
|
@ -176,6 +176,15 @@ public class ManagerDetachServiceImpl extends Service implements ManagerDetachSe
|
|
|
|
|
return new BaseBean().getPropValue("hrmOrganization", "detach");
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
@Override
|
|
|
|
|
public List<Integer> selectManagerDetachByUid() {
|
|
|
|
|
ManagerDetachPO managerDetach = getMangeDetachMapper().selectManagerDetachByUid(user.getUID());
|
|
|
|
|
List<Integer> subCompanyIds = Arrays.stream(managerDetach.getEcRolelevel().split(","))
|
|
|
|
|
.map(Integer::parseInt)
|
|
|
|
|
.collect(Collectors.toList());
|
|
|
|
|
return subCompanyIds;
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
private String buildSqlWhere(Map<String, Object> params) {
|
|
|
|
|
DBType dbType = DBType.get(new RecordSet().getDBType());
|
|
|
|
|
String sqlWhere = " where delete_type = 0";
|
|
|
|
|